and Europe: Berlusconi asks for intervention on overvalued Euro.

European Union (EU) leaders clashed on how to tackle soaring oil prices at their first day of a summit which kicked off Thursday.

While France and Austria pressed for a cut in value added tax (VAT) on petrol to counter skyrocketing oil prices, Germany and Sweden made it clear they were opposed to any tax measure that would distort market demand and delay long-term adjustment.
